Age | Commit message (Expand) | Author |
2022-07-29 | ripple/minitrace: verify newfstatat flags strictly | edef |
2022-07-29 | ripple/minitrace: replace read_mem_cstr calls with CString arguments | edef |
2022-07-29 | ripple/minitrace: interpret CString arguments to syscalls | edef |
2022-07-29 | ripple/minitrace: don't impl Copy for SyscallEntry | edef |
2022-07-29 | ripple/minitrace: use inline variable style for format strings | edef |
2022-07-29 | ripple/minitrace: match read_mem_cstr return value names to input names | edef |
2022-07-29 | ripple/minitrace: verify that libc flag naming matches | edef |
2022-07-29 | ripple/minitrace: convert OpenFlags to bitshifts | edef |
2022-07-29 | ripple/minitrace: verify syscall bitflags against libc | edef |
2022-07-29 | ripple/minitrace: make syscall_bitflags! non-recursive | edef |
2022-07-29 | ripple/minitrace: match identifier style in macros | edef |
2022-07-29 | ripple/minitrace: pluralise newfstatat flags parameter | edef |
2022-07-28 | ripple/minitrace: bitflags-ify mmap/mprotect protection flags | edef |
2022-07-28 | ripple/minitrace: mark file descriptor parameters | edef |
2022-07-27 | ripple/minitrace: remove GRND_ prefix from GrndFlags | edef |
2022-07-27 | ripple/minitrace: parse mmap flags strictly | edef |
2022-07-27 | ripple/minitrace: mmap fd is an i32, not u64 | edef |
2022-07-27 | ripple/minitrace: better errors for invalid syscall args | edef |
2022-07-27 | ripple/minitrace: introduce syscall_bitflags! | edef |
2022-07-27 | ripple/minitrace: implement SyscallArg for bitflags | edef |
2022-07-27 | ripple/minitrace: disable dead_code lint on SyscallArgs | edef |
2022-07-27 | ripple/minitrace: refactor syscall interpretation | V |
2022-07-27 | ripple/minitrace: fix newfstatat dirfd handling | edef |
2022-07-08 | ripple/minitrace: convert openat dirfd correctly | edef |
2022-06-19 | ripple/minitrace: fix syscall ABI | V |
2022-06-17 | ripple/minitrace: add set_tid_address, set_robust_list, and getrandom | V |
2022-02-28 | ripple: bump Rust edition to 2021 | V |
2022-02-16 | ripple/minitrace: use CString::from_vec_with_nul for construction | V |
2022-02-08 | ripple/minitrace: clean up prlimit64 arg destructuring | V |
2022-02-08 | ripple/minitrace: clean up arch_prctl arg destructuring | V |
2022-02-08 | ripple/minitrace: log newfstatat paths | V |
2022-02-08 | ripple/minitrace: log readlink paths | edef |
2022-02-08 | ripple/minitrace: clean up ioctl handling | V |
2022-02-08 | ripple/minitrace: log access(2) paths | edef |
2022-02-08 | ripple/minitrace: consistently use .. for arg matching | edef |
2022-02-08 | ripple/minitrace: clear child environment variables | edef |
2022-02-08 | ripple/minitrace: enforce openat flags | edef |
2022-02-08 | ripple/minitrace: log openat paths | edef |
2022-02-08 | ripple/minitrace: ensure openat calls use AT_FDCWD only | edef |
2022-02-07 | ripple/minitrace: use anyhow::Result unqualified | edef |
2022-02-03 | ripple/minitrace: don't permit tracee escape if the tracer dies | edef |
2022-02-03 | ripple/minitrace: only disable ASLR in tracee | edef |
2022-02-03 | ripple/minitrace: take care of our own ptrace bringup | edef |
2021-12-28 | ripple/minitrace: disable ASLR | edef |
2021-12-28 | ripple: upgrade nix crate to 0.23.1 | edef |
2021-12-28 | ripple/minitrace: enforce arguments for arch_prctl, prlimit64, ioctl, mmap | edef |
2021-12-27 | ripple/minitrace: enforce permitted syscall numbers | edef |
2021-12-27 | ripple/minitrace: init | edef |